UNIXコマンドのwatchというコマンドがありますが、サーバー管理でのあなたの具体的な活用方法を教えてください。Web/Aplication/DBなど、サーバーの種類は問いません。

回答の条件
  • URL必須
  • 1人1回まで
  • 登録:2008/07/01 08:39:17
  • 終了:2008/07/08 08:40:02

回答(3件)

id:poch-7003 No.1

poch-7003回答回数43ベストアンサー獲得回数82008/07/01 10:34:47

ポイント27pt

やはりリアルタイムに近い状態で確認したいときに使いますね.

#tail -f hoge.logのような

よく使うものは

#オプションで指定できるコマンドもありますが,バッファが食われてしまうので.好き嫌いですが

watch -d ifconfig eth0
watch -n1 -d free -k
watch -d vmstat
watch -d df
watch ls -la /tmp
watch netstat -latp
watch 'netstat -latvpn |grep :443'
watch ipcs -m

http://linux.about.com/library/cmd/blcmdl1_watch.htm

id:yokoyamen

素晴らしいです。各コマンドを使う場合のシチュエーションなども併記いただければ尚助かります。

2008/07/01 12:55:28
id:GHBq96 No.2

GHB回答回数15ベストアンサー獲得回数12008/07/01 13:33:25

ポイント27pt

ファイルコピー中に進行状況を見たいときに

watch -n 20 ls -l hoge

プロセス監視に

watch -d 'ps -ef | grep hoge'

後ネタ用に

watch -n 60 'banner `date +%H:%M`'

ただ最近標準でbanner入れてあるLinuxあまり見ないですが。

http://www.linux.or.jp/JM/html/procps/man1/watch.1.html

id:yokoyamen

ありがとうございます。

2008/07/01 14:22:27
id:rubikitch No.3

るびきち回答回数120ベストアンサー獲得回数222008/07/02 00:05:08

ポイント26pt

メモリの状況を監視するのに

watch cat /proc/meminfo

を使っています。

http://www.google.com/search?q=%2Fproc%2Fmeminfo&hl=ja&num=100

id:yokoyamen

ありがとうございます。

2008/07/02 21:59:42

コメントはまだありません

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ません